!OBITUARY- MRS. O. L. BROWN: From Joe Brown
"Mrs. O. L. Brown, seventy-eight, who died last night at the home of her daugher, Mrs. Blanche Coley, in Corsicana, will be buried in Frost tomorrow morning at 10 o'clock. She is survived by three sons, Lee Brown of Fort Worth and Frank Brown and J. B. Brown of Frost; three daughters, Mrs. Jack Harrington, Frost, Mrs. Blanche Coley, Corsicana, and Mrs. Maude Osburn; six brothers, J. N. Youngblood, C. C. Youngblood, W. H. Youngblood, and Dr. D. J. R. Youngblood, and one sister, Mrs. Annie Southard."
